Explanation;

There are three major ways of incorporating other writers' work into your own writing. These includes;

-paraphrasing which involves putting a passage from source material into your own words (restating the text or main idea in their own words).

-Summarizing involves putting the main idea(s) into your own words, including only the main point(s).

-Quotation which involves making an exact copy of the words of another author using a narrow segment of the source.
